This is tonight. Just the one addition to the main card in RUSH v. Dragon Lee. With a few more to the pre-show. Feels like the 6-man titles might have been dug up as a vehicle for Tully Blanchard Enterprises considering what they're doing with Cage & Gates of Agony.

  1. World Title: Jonathan Gresham (c) v. Claudio Castagnoli
  2. TV Title: Samoa Joe (c) v. Jay Lethal
  3. Tag Team Titles (2/3 Falls): FTR (c) v. The Briscoes
  4. Women's Title: Mercedes Martinez (c) v. Serena Deeb
  5. Pure Title: Wheeler Yuta (c) v. Daniel Garcia
  6. 6-Man Titles: The Righteous (c) v. Dalton Castle & The Boys
  7. RUSH v. Dragon Lee
  8. Pre-Show: Willow Nightingale v. Allysin Kay
  9. Pre-Show: Brian Cage & Gates of Agony v. Alex Zayne, Blake Christian, Tony Deppen
  10. Pre-Show: Colt Cabana v. Anthony Henry
  11. Pre-Show: Shinobi Shadow Squad v. Trustbusters
